Dreaming of Route 66 - Just a few months before I contracted MG, I took a 30-day journey from Chicago to L.A. on Route 66. I had been dreaming of doing it for years, and I'm glad I did it when I did it because had I waited one more year I would not have been able to do it. Along the way I documented many places that were once thriving businesses, but are now just ghost shells of buildings. In this render, I used DAZ's Moonshine Diner and 1950's car to create a "dream" superimposed over a current-day Route 66 scene. I imagined a drive-in diner with a young lady driving a 1956 Chevy DeLuxe Coupe as she starts to pull over to pick up a burger, fries and a Coke. The present day scene still haunts the road - an old Motel, and some outbuildings are all that's left of the small town. Photo from my September, 2017, Route 66 trip. Car and diner rendered in DAZ3D 4.10. Final image digitally painted.
